Balzheimer Berg
Balzheimer Berg is a hill in Erolzheim, Biberach, Baden-Württemberg and has an elevation of 598 metres. Balzheimer Berg is situated nearby to the locality Erolzheim, as well as near the village Bechtenrot.Places of Interest

Kirchberg an der Iller is a municipality in Baden-Württemberg in the south-west of Germany and in the very east of the "Landkreis Biberach". Biberach is the capital of the district. Kirchberg an der Iller is situated 4 km north of Balzheimer Berg.
